This text is the second of three volumes looking at the history of France. This volume examines how and why events and figures become part of a people's collective memory. It emphasizes the shared aspects of French history and cultural instrumental in the development of a national identity. It includes 14 essays on subjects ranging from Proust's "Remembrance of Things Past" to the Tour de France.
